{"id":2497,"date":"2005-04-27T03:28:55","date_gmt":"2005-04-27T03:28:55","guid":{"rendered":"http:\/\/www.soulhuntre.com\/items\/date\/2005\/04\/27\/update-mysql-database-structures-tasty\/"},"modified":"2005-04-27T03:28:55","modified_gmt":"2005-04-27T03:28:55","slug":"update-mysql-database-structures-tasty","status":"publish","type":"post","link":"http:\/\/legacyiamsenseiken.local\/2005\/04\/27\/update-mysql-database-structures-tasty\/","title":{"rendered":"Update MySQL database structures? Tasty!"},"content":{"rendered":"

So your developing, and you have to alter a database structure to match from one versiont o another. You want to automate this process…. but how?<\/p>\n

MySQLdiff<\/a> to the rescue: <\/p>\n

\n

“MySQLdiff is a little Tool to detect layout differences between two databases.<\/p>\n

Almost every developer knows the that changes of the database on the developement system have to be logged in order to update the live-system later on.<\/p>\n

To make this easier the tool MySQLdiff has been developed. Not as a real project but …<\/p>\n

MySQLdiff will create a SQL-ALTER-Script which has to be run onto the live-system to ‘patch’ it to the state of the developement system. “<\/p>\n<\/blockquote>\n

I might be in love.<\/p>\n","protected":false},"excerpt":{"rendered":"

So your developing, and you have to alter a database structure to match from one versiont o another. You want to automate this process…. but how? MySQLdiff to the rescue: “MySQLdiff is a little Tool to detect layout differences between two databases. Almost every developer knows the that changes of the database on the developement […]<\/p>\n","protected":false},"author":3,"featured_media":53203,"comment_status":"open","ping_status":"open","sticky":false,"template":"","format":"aside","meta":{"footnotes":""},"categories":[278],"tags":[],"_links":{"self":[{"href":"http:\/\/legacyiamsenseiken.local\/wp-json\/wp\/v2\/posts\/2497"}],"collection":[{"href":"http:\/\/legacyiamsenseiken.local\/wp-json\/wp\/v2\/posts"}],"about":[{"href":"http:\/\/legacyiamsenseiken.local\/wp-json\/wp\/v2\/types\/post"}],"author":[{"embeddable":true,"href":"http:\/\/legacyiamsenseiken.local\/wp-json\/wp\/v2\/users\/3"}],"replies":[{"embeddable":true,"href":"http:\/\/legacyiamsenseiken.local\/wp-json\/wp\/v2\/comments?post=2497"}],"version-history":[{"count":0,"href":"http:\/\/legacyiamsenseiken.local\/wp-json\/wp\/v2\/posts\/2497\/revisions"}],"wp:featuredmedia":[{"embeddable":true,"href":"http:\/\/legacyiamsenseiken.local\/wp-json\/wp\/v2\/media\/53203"}],"wp:attachment":[{"href":"http:\/\/legacyiamsenseiken.local\/wp-json\/wp\/v2\/media?parent=2497"}],"wp:term":[{"taxonomy":"category","embeddable":true,"href":"http:\/\/legacyiamsenseiken.local\/wp-json\/wp\/v2\/categories?post=2497"},{"taxonomy":"post_tag","embeddable":true,"href":"http:\/\/legacyiamsenseiken.local\/wp-json\/wp\/v2\/tags?post=2497"}],"curies":[{"name":"wp","href":"https:\/\/api.w.org\/{rel}","templated":true}]}}